GameStop Operating Expenses Growth & History (GME)

GameStop's operating expenses was $964.0M for fiscal 2025.

GameStop annual operating expenses history

GameStop annual operating expenses

Fiscal yearPeriod endedOperating expensesChangeGrowth
20252026-01-31$964.0M−$176.1M−15.45%
20242025-02-01$1.14B−$188.6M−14.19%
20232024-02-03$1.33B−$355.0M−21.08%
20222023-01-28$1.68B−$32.6M−1.90%
20212022-01-29$1.72B$219.0M+14.63%
20202021-01-30$1.50B−$811.0M−35.13%
20192020-02-01$2.31B−$701.8M−23.31%
20182019-02-02$3.01B$964.4M+47.14%
20172018-02-03$2.05B$27.5M+1.36%
20162017-01-28$2.02B−$251.9M−11.10%
20152016-01-30$2.27B$112.5M+5.21%
20142015-01-31$2.16B$70.0M+3.35%
20132014-02-01$2.09B−$605.5M−22.48%
20122013-02-02$2.69B$583.5M+27.66%
20112012-01-28$2.11B$234.6M+12.51%
20102011-01-29$1.88B$77.3M+4.30%
20092010-01-30$1.80B$202.7M+12.71%
20082009-01-31$1.59B$282.7M+21.54%
20072008-02-02$1.31B

GameStop operating expenses trends

Over the last five fiscal years, GameStop's operating expenses decreased from $1.50B to $964.0M, a change of −$533.3M. The latest reported quarter, Q1 2026, shows $197.0M.

About the metric

What operating expenses mean

Operating expenses are the recurring costs of running a company’s business beyond the direct costs used to calculate gross profit. They commonly include selling, general and administrative expenses, research and development, and other operating costs.

Calculation and source

SEC-reported and calculated operating expenses

TickerStat uses operating expenses reported in company SEC filings when available. When a separate total is unavailable, it calculates operating expenses as aligned gross profit minus operating income for the same fiscal period. Fiscal periods can differ from calendar years, so exact period-end dates are included.
